Walnut Room this way

Walnut Room this way

Sunday, February 8, 2009

Uncle Sam and other little-known secrets

Beautiful day for birds and beasts alike yesterday and today: 70.

The Statue of Liberty is actually located on Winchester Street, Memphis, Tennessee.

Uncle Sam also lives in Memphis, and he is Black.


coachk said...

this made me laugh out loud, very very funny

Suzassippi said...

You should have seen him dancing! I took a video, but cannot get it to load.